Comprehending the Art Behind Metal Stamping


At its core, metal stamping is the process of changing level metal sheets into details forms with force and accuracy. This isn't a one-size-fits-all procedure; it includes several strategies like bending, punching, coining, and embossing-- each picked for the task at hand. Every bend and cut is executed with unbelievable precision, directed by the devices and passes away crafted for the task.


This process demands greater than just equipments-- it needs a knowledgeable group and advanced innovation. The artistry of tool and die shops depend on creating custom passes away that allow for the specific reproduction of components, down to the tiniest detail. Whether generating basic brackets or complicated automotive parts, precision is non-negotiable.


Just How Metal Stamping Powers Modern Living


Browse your home or office and you'll discover countless products gave birth to by metal stamping. The structural structure of your dishwasher, the ports in your smart device, the bracket holding your auto's dashboard-- all these parts owe their presence to stamped steel.


In the automobile globe, the need for sturdiness and uniformity makes progressive die stamping a preferred. This method entails a series of stations, each doing an one-of-a-kind function as the metal developments via journalism. It's perfect for high-volume runs and makes sure each item fulfills exacting criteria.


But it doesn't stop with automobiles. In the clinical area, where integrity can be a matter of life and death, metal stamping is used to craft surgical tools and device components. In the aerospace industry, stamped components must stand up to severe problems while fulfilling limited resistances. The exact same is true in consumer electronics, where space-saving, high-functionality designs ask for stamped steel components that are both light-weight and solid.


Precision, Speed, and Reliability: Why Metal Stamping Matters


So why has metal stamping become such a go-to approach throughout many markets? Firstly: speed. Once the passes away are established, countless identical components can be created with little variation. This level of repeatability is vital when uniformity matters.


After that there's the concern of cost-effectiveness. Conventional machining might take longer and entail more product waste. However stamping, specifically when made with progressive die technology, maintains manufacturing moving fast and efficiently. It's one of the most intelligent means to satisfy high-volume manufacturing objectives without compromising quality.


The integrity of this process also can not be overstated. When you're generating thousands-- and even millions-- of components, a little flaw can come to be a huge trouble. That's why partnering with a knowledgeable tool and die company is so vital. The right group ensures every component is made to spec, every time.

Evolving With Industry Demands


As industries remain to evolve, so also does metal stamping. Suppliers are discovering brand-new alloys, tighter resistances, and much more compact designs. With these changes come brand-new difficulties-- and chances.


For instance, as electric vehicles (EVs) gain appeal, there's a growing need for light-weight parts that can stand up to high performance and extreme temperature levels. Marking meets these needs, supplying strong yet reliable components without adding mass.


Smart home devices and wearables also rely upon stamped metal components to keep their accounts smooth while safeguarding delicate interior parts. The increase of miniaturization is pressing the limits of what metal stamping can do, and the best tool and die company will constantly be ready to introduce alongside sector patterns.
